Dates: Thursday, June 1st through Sunday, June 4th
Site: TPC at Avenel, Potomac, Maryland
Course Architect: Ed Ault and Tom Clark (1986)
Ed Sneed (Consultant)
Par: 71
Yardage: 7,005
Hole-by-Hole: 1 - Par 4 393 yds 10 - Par 4 374 yds
2 - Par 5 622 yds 11 - Par 3 165 yds
3 - Par 3 239 yds 12 - Par 4 472 yds
4 - Par 4 435 yds 13 - Par 5 524 yds
5 - Par 4 359 yds 14 - Par 4 301 yds
6 - Par 5 520 yds 15 - Par 4 467 yds
7 - Par 4 461 yds 16 - Par 4 415 yds
8 - Par 4 453 yds 17 - Par 3 195 yds
9 - Par 3 166 yds 18 - Par 4 444 yds
------------- -------------
36 3,648 yds 35 3,357 yds
Annual: 33rd
Defending Champion: Rich Beem
Runner-Up: Bill Glasson, Bradley Hughes
Tournament Record: 263 (Billy Andrade, Jeff Sluman, 1991)
54-Hole Record: 195 (Hal Sutton, 1991)
36-Hole Record: 130 (Fred Funk, 1998)
Course Record: 63 (Ted Schulz, 1991; David Toms, 1992; Davis Love III, 1995;
Corey Pavin, 1995-96; Stuart Appleby, 1998)
18-Hole Record: 61 (Jerry McGee, 1979 - Quail Hollow)
Total Purse: $3,000,000
Shares: 1st Place - $540,000; 2nd Place - 324,000; 3rd Place - 204,000

Past Kemper Insurance Open Winners and Runners-up
-------------------------------------------------
1999 -- Rich Beem (274) -- Bill Glasson, Bradley Hughes
1998 -- Stuart Appleby (274) -- Scott Hoch
1997 -- Justin Leonard (274) -- Mark Wiebe
1996 -- Steve Stricker (270) -- Brad Faxon, Scott Hoch, M.O'Meara, G.Waite
1995 -- *Lee Janzen (272) -- Corey Pavin
1994 -- Mark Brooks (271) -- Bobby Wadkins, D.A. Weibring
1993 -- Grant Waite (275) -- Tom Kite
1992 -- Bill Glasson (276) -- J.Daly, Ken Green, Mike Springer, H.Twitty
1991 -- *Billy Andrade (263) -- Jeff Sluman
1990 -- Gil Morgan (274) -- Ian Baker-Finch
1989 -- Tom Byrum (268) -- Tommy Armour III, Billy Ray Brown, Jim Thorpe
1988 -- *Morris Hatalsky (274) -- Tom Kite
1987 -- Tom Kite (270) -- Chris Perry, Howard Twitty
1986 -- *Greg Norman (277) -- Larry Mize
1985 -- Bill Glasson (278) -- Larry Mize, Corey Pavin
1984 -- Greg Norman (280) -- Mark O'Meara
1983 -- *Fred Couples (287) -- T.C. Chen, B.Jaeckel, G.Morgan, S.Simpson
1982 -- Craig Stadler (275) -- Seve Ballesteros
1981 -- Craig Stadler (270) -- Tom Watson, Tom Weiskopf
1980 -- John Mahaffey (275) -- Craig Stadler
1979 -- Jerry McGee (272) -- Jerry Pate
1978 -- Andy Bean (273) -- Mark Hayes, Andy North
1977 -- Tom Weiskopf (277) -- George Burns, Bill Rogers
1976 -- Joe Inman (277) -- Grier Jones, Tom Weiskopf
1975 -- Ray Floyd (278) -- John Mahaffey, Gary Player
1974 -- *Bob Menne (270) -- Jerry Heard
1973 -- Tom Weiskopf (271) -- Lanny Wadkins
1972 -- Doug Sanders (275) -- Lee Trevino
1971 -- *Tom Weiskopf (277) -- Dale Douglass, Gary Player, Lee Trevino
1970 -- Dick Lotz (278) -- Lou Graham, Larry Hinson, G.Jones, T.Weiskopf
1969 -- Dale Douglass (274) -- Charles Coody
1968 -- Arnold Palmer (276) -- Bruce Crampton, Art Wall
* - Won in Playoff
Note: Formely called Kemper Open (1968-99).
Top Contenders in the Field
---------------------------
Rich Beem - Defending Champion, has made only 4 of 15 cuts, no top-10's
Robert Allenby - Won earlier this year, 14th on money list, 2 top-10's
Brad Elder - Finished 12th last week to move up to 69th on money list
Ernie Els - Finished 2nd last week for the third time this year
Carlos Franco - Defended title at New Orleans, 12th on money list
Fred Funk - Has made 12 of 14 cuts this year but only 1 top-10 finish
Scott Hoch - Played the last three rounds in eight under last week
Lee Janzen - Won this event in 1995, only 1 top-10 in 13 tournaments
Tom Lehman - 7th on money list with one win and six top-10 finishes
Justin Leonard - Posted first top-10 last week, tying for 2nd at Memorial
Steve Lowery - Played in final group with Tiger last week and shot 73
Mark O'Meara - Two-time Major winner trying to get game in shape
Jeff Sluman - Only top-50 money winner this year without a top-10
David Toms - Has made 14 of 15 cuts this year with two top-five's
